Last 12 Months of Data

Hello,

In my Sales report, I need to show last 12 months of data.

Data is refreshed at the start of each month and the last months data is added (e.g., in early June, we will add May data).  

How do i automatically add the new month (May in this case) in the sales bar chart and remove May 2022 data? 

I am trying a measure Last 12 Months = EOMONTH(Today(), -12) - have not figured out how to do a comparison to the date in the date table.  

Also, I do have a date slicer, in case the user wants to see than 12 or more than 12 months.

Hello PavBid,

 

You can accomplish this from the filter tab; simply add a relative date filter for the last twelve months.
